Photographs of the play Whylah Falls
Part of Joy O'Brien fonds
File contains photographs related to Eastern Front Theatre and the National Arts Centre's theatrical production, "Whylah Falls," in 2000. The play was written by George Elliot Clark.
Photographs feature Linda Carvery, Novelee Buchan, and others.

Documents related to Nova Scotia Mass Choir
Part of Joy O'Brien fonds
File contains documents related to Nova Scotia Mass Choir in 2001.
Documents include programs, itineraries, and newspaper clippings related to Symphony Nova Scotia, the Martin Luther King tribute concert, the Black Business Summit at Casino Nova Scotia, the annual Nova Scotia Multicultural Festival, African Heritage Month, the South African Polokwane Choral Society, Jeremiah Sparks' farewell party, and the Halifax Regional Municipality tree lighting.
File also includes a Nova Scotia Mass Choir contact list, including names, phone numbers, and addresses of members.
